Superstar Salman Khan is outspoken, a frank human being and is afraid of nobody. The Bollywood's bhaijaan is all set to entertain the audiences with his first release of this year Bharat on June 5. Directed by Ali Abbas Zafar, the film also stars Tabu, Disha Patani, Sunil Grover and Jackie Shroff. It traces India’s post-independence history from the perspective of a common man and follows his life from the range of 18 to 70 years of age, as a journey.

Salman Khan will sport five different looks in the film. In an interview India Today, he was asked how he decided his look in the film and the actor said, "Basically all my cousin's all they have the same look. So, most of them in Indore, they had salt-and-pepper look. They all have the same look. From my dad's brother-in-law to that whole family, we call them bhaiya ji. Everyone of my cousin's have that same look."

On the occasion, Salman further went on to reveal that how he prepared for his role in Bharat and how he took inspiration from his own journey in the Hindi film industry to play his role in the film.

“I had to prepare mentally more for Bharat. I looked back to the time when I started doing films, then how I changed after 20 years of starting my career. I revisited films and interviews of that time. I laughed at myself, I felt the cringe element also - I shouldn't have done that. I learnt from my journey. I reduced weight for Sultan (2016). In Bharat, I had to reduce weight for every decade. Also, the film involves a lot of action and thrill so that also required a lot of hard work,” he was quoted as saying by India Today.

Previously, it was revealed that Salman Khan devoted 2.5 hours before the shoot to get into his salt and pepper look for the film. Also, Katrina had devoted as many as 2 hours to get her middle-aged look right.

It is to be noted that Bharat is produced by Atul Agnihotri, Alvira Agnihotri, Bhushan Kumar, Krishan Kumar under the banner of Reel Life Production Pvt Ltd. and Salman Khan Films, presented by T-Series.
